Row over 'killer cat'
By Richard Edwards, Evening Standard
13 December 2004
He was named after UN Secretary General and Nobel Peace Prize winner Kofi Annan - but Kofi the cat is hardly living up to his epithet.
The five-year-old bengal is accused of fighting every cat in his London suburb, killing one and leaving two others so traumatised they had to be put down.
His owners, Chris and Caroline Hykiel, insist he is no "vicious beast" - despite installing a cage in their back garden to keep him in during the day.
